Cohort 2 Of 1Youth, 2Skills Scheme Set For Empowerment As Contractors Continue To Receive Prompt Payments

The 15th Anambra State Executive Council (ANSEC) meeting, held on July 21, 2025, at the Light House in Awka, made the following significant decisions:

1. *Approval of Funds for Cohort 2 Empowerment under the 1Youth, 2Skills Scheme*

 

According to Dr Law Mefor, the Honourable Commissioner for Information, the Council reviewed the success of Cohort 1 of the Soludo administration’s flagship youth empowerment programme, where 7,163 out of 11,000 trainees excelled in 65 skill areas. Additionally, 235 Umuboi (apprentices) from the Local Enterprise Development of 21 local governments in the state were successful, with over 1,000 millionaires emerging from the graduates. Funds for the empowerment of Cohort 2 were approved, as they are ready for commissioning.

2. *Contractors to Continue Receiving Prompt Payments*

The Council reaffirmed the state’s contractor payment system, ensuring that no contractors are owed. This policy has been in place since the inception of the Soludo government over three years ago.

3. *Awka City Park Project*

The Council approved the Awka City Park Project, which will provide environmental, aesthetic, and recreational benefits to the Awka capital city, along with social, health, and economic benefits. Work on the project is set to begin without delay.

*Approved Projects and Funding*

The Council approved the release of N2,835,150,000 for the following projects:

– 1Youth 2Skills Business Financing Scheme: N2,588,520,000
– 1Youth 2Skills Cooperatives Start-up: N141,900,000
– Graduation and Certification: N73,230,000
– 1Youth 2Skills Mentorship Scheme: N31,000,000
– Consolation to the Deceased Family: N500,000
